Muslim Grooming Gangs: 32 men charged with almost 200 sexual exploitation offences against 8 girls as young as 13 in West Yorkshire

Police probing an alleged grooming gang have charged 32 men with almost 200 offences against girls as young as 13.
 
The alleged offences date from 1999 to 2012 against eight girls in Kirklees, Bradford and Wakefield.
 
Police say the men are charged with a number of offences – including rape, sexual activity with a child, trafficking and false imprisonment.
 
There are 196 counts among the defendants in total against eight girls aged between 13 and 16.
 
The defendants, aged between 31 and 50, are due to appear at Kirklees Magistrates Court on either December 11 or 14.
 
They were held by cops probing non-recent child sexual exploitation in parts of West Yorkshire as part of Operation Tourway.
 
Cops say some of the victims were also subjected to offences when they were young adults.
 
Among those held by cops are 50-year-old Asif Ali, who is charged with 12 rape offences and Zafar Qayum, 41, who is charged with 17.
 
Irfan Khan, 34, is charged with threats to kill and false imprisonment.
 
West Yorkshire Police said: “Thirty two men, largely from the Kirklees area, have been charged with a variety of offences as part of Operation Tourway, an investigation into non-recent child sexual exploitation in parts of West Yorkshire.
 
“The allegations against the defendants are from 1999 to 2012 and involve offences committed against eight female victims, who were aged between 13 and 16 years old at the time of the alleged offences.
 
“Some of the victims were also subjected to offences when they were young adults.
 
“Locations in which the alleged offending took place include parts of Kirklees, Bradford and Wakefield.”
